## Why Waterproof Flooring Issues for Outdoors Tents
Outdoors tents are exposed to the aspects, and wetness is among the largest threats to a comfy camping experience. Ground wetness leaks up from below, rainfall can blow in from the sides, and early morning dew includes in the dampness. Without proper waterproof flooring, you risk damp resting gear, mold growth, and an uncomfortably chilly surface area underfoot. The ideal floor covering produces an obstacle in between the ground and your home, keeping things completely dry, tidy, and dramatically extra comfortable.
## Top Waterproof Floor Covering Alternatives for Outdoors Tents
### Foam Interlocking Shingles
Foam interlocking floor tiles, usually made from EVA (ethylene plastic acetate) foam, are just one of one of the most preferred options for camping tent flooring. They're lightweight, simple to bring, and snap together quickly with no devices. Their closed-cell foam construction makes them normally resistant to wetness, protecting against water from soaking through to the ground under.
These floor tiles can be found in various densities-- usually ranging from 12mm to 20mm-- which also provides outstanding insulation against cool ground temperature levels. They're soft underfoot, making them ideal for household camping, yoga retreats, or event outdoors tents where individuals might be standing or sitting for long periods. Clean-up is basic as well; just wipe them down with a damp towel.
### Rubber Floor Covering Mats
Rubber floor coverings are a durable water resistant option ideal suited for bigger, semi-permanent outdoor tents setups. They're incredibly durable, resistant to tearing, and take care of heavy foot traffic effortlessly. Rubber is normally water-proof and doesn't take in dampness, making it excellent for rainy problems or areas with high ground wetness.
The disadvantage is weight-- rubber mats are dramatically heavier than foam alternatives, making them much less sensible for backpacking or frequent setup changes. Nevertheless, for glamping sites, outdoor markets, or occasion camping tents that stay in location for days or weeks, rubber floor covering is a durable and reliable financial investment.
### Plastic Flooring Rolls
Vinyl flooring rolls offer a more polished aesthetic while still delivering strong water-proof performance. Made from PVC, vinyl is 100% water resistant, simple to tidy, and readily available in a vast array of patterns and shades-- including styles that simulate timber, rock, or floor tile. This makes it a prominent option for glamping setups where design and convenience are just as essential as usefulness.
Vinyl flooring is additionally relatively slim and versatile, permitting it to roll up for transport and storage space. While it's not as supported as foam tiles, it supplies a company, stable surface area that really feels refined and put-together. For occasion tents, photography arrangements, or upscale camping experiences, plastic rolls are an excellent choice.
### Carpeting Tiles with Water-proof Support
For those who desire heat and comfort underfoot, carpeting tiles with a water-proof backing strike a wonderful balance. The soft carpet surface area supplies insulation and padding, while the water resistant backing protects against wetness from soaking through from the ground. These ceramic tiles are very easy to set up and replace, and lots of can be cleaned or hosed down after usage.
They're particularly fit for prolonged camping journeys, outdoor occasions in cooler climates, or family members camping tents where children will certainly be playing on the flooring. Remember that the carpet surface area itself can still hold surface dampness if water spills, so they work best in settings where rainfall exposure from above is marginal.
### Polyethylene Ground Sheets
Often called impact tarpaulins or ground cloths, polyethylene ground sheets are the most basic and most budget-friendly water resistant floor covering option. They're basically thick plastic sheeting cut to fit under or inside your tent. While they don't provide cushioning or insulation, they develop a reliable dampness obstacle and weigh next to nothing.
Ground sheets are perfect as a base layer below any other floor covering alternative, including an additional level of waterproofing. They're likewise beneficial for shielding camping supply the outdoor tents flooring itself from abrasion and punctures.
## How to Choose the Right Option
When selecting waterproof tent flooring, consider the following factors:
The period and sort of your arrangement matters most. Brief outdoor camping trips call for light-weight foam ceramic tiles or a straightforward ground sheet, while longer or more long-term configurations gain from heavier, more resilient materials like rubber or vinyl.
Consider the climate and conditions. In wet or muddy atmospheres, prioritize products with the highest wetness resistance and simple drainage. For colder climates, select choices with thermal insulation properties like foam or carpet ceramic tiles.
Mobility is an additional key aspect. If you're hiking to your camping site, every ounce matters. Foam ceramic tiles and ground sheets pack down tiny and light. If you're driving or establishing a repaired framework, weight is much less of an issue.
